New NetFORCE 900 Provides up to 4.8TB Capacity in 3U Enclosure, Uses Procom's Innovative Enterprise-Class OS, and is Ideal for Both Primary and Secondary Storage

IRVINE, Calif., Dec. 17, 2004 (PRIMEZONE) -- Addressing the needs of cost-sensitive customers, Procom Technology, Inc. (Pink Sheets:PRCM), a value leader in network attached storage (NAS) solutions, has introduced a powerful new high-capacity, budget-priced model to extend its recently developed line of SATA-based NAS filers. The new NetFORCE 900 provides up to 4.8 terabytes of raw storage capacity in a mere 3U (5.25-inch) enclosure and -- with prices starting at only $9,995 -- offers a higher storage density and lower cost per gigabyte than almost any other NAS appliance on the market. Procom believes that the affordable new NF900 is ideally suited for small- and medium-sized businesses, workgroups, and departments of large organizations that need large amounts of very economical storage that is easy to deploy and manage. It is especially suited for the telecommunications industry because of the unit's uniquely short 21-inch depth and available -48 volt DC power supplies, allowing it to easily integrate into many telco environments. The new SATA disk-based NF900 uses Procom's industry-acclaimed enterprise-class operating system -- the very same innovative, sophisticated OS deployed in the company's high-end NAS filers. It provides advanced reliability features such as a journaling file system to ensure data integrity and checkpoints for rapid recovery of damaged or deleted files. Other functionalities include cross-platform heterogeneous file sharing, full SNMP monitoring, local SCSI backup options, and support for NDMP (v2 and v3). The NF900 is built upon an Intel Xeon-based hardware platform that allows it to deliver high performance with exceptional reliability. Robust data availability is provided by built-in hardware RAID with battery-backed cache, hot-swappable drives and power supplies, and optional UPS (uninterruptible power supplies). The system is powerful enough to deploy as a primary storage solution and economical enough to use for secondary storage and near-line backup applications. For true 24/7 business continuance, Procom's multi-featured ProMirror disaster recovery software option can maintain a near real-time copy of mission-critical data at a geographically remote site. The NF900 is easy to install, maintain and operate, with RAID and system management provided by a Web-based graphical user interface that allows remote administration and system monitoring from anywhere in the world.
